How Do Different Features Affect Performance?
- Draw Weight: The draw weight of a crossbow upper determines how much force is required to pull back the string. Higher draw weights can lead to faster arrow speeds and greater penetration power, but they may also require more physical strength to operate effectively.
- Power Stroke: The power stroke refers to the distance the string travels when the crossbow is fired. A longer power stroke can generally produce more energy and velocity, resulting in improved accuracy and impact force upon hitting the target.
- Material Composition: The materials used in the construction of the crossbow upper can affect its durability, weight, and vibration absorption. High-quality materials like aluminum or carbon fiber can enhance performance by providing strength without adding unnecessary weight.
- Optics and Sights: The type and quality of optics or sighting systems integrated with the crossbow upper can greatly influence aiming precision. Advanced optics can help in long-range shooting by providing clearer images and better reticles, thus improving overall accuracy.
- Stock Design: The design of the stock affects comfort and stability during use. Ergonomically designed stocks can improve handling and reduce fatigue, allowing for better aim and control when firing.
- Trigger Mechanism: The trigger mechanism’s quality and responsiveness play a crucial role in shooting performance. A smooth and crisp trigger pull can enhance accuracy by minimizing the movement of the crossbow during the shot.
- Cocking Mechanism: The type of cocking mechanism (manual, crank, or auto) impacts ease of use and the speed of preparing the crossbow for the next shot. A more efficient cocking system can enhance the user experience, especially during prolonged shooting sessions.

How Do Various Crossbow Uppers Suit Different Types of Hunting?
The best crossbow upper options cater to different hunting styles and preferences.
- Standard Crossbow Upper: This type is designed for general hunting purposes, offering a balance between power and accuracy. It typically features a draw weight between 150-180 lbs, making it suitable for taking down medium-sized game like deer or wild boar.
- Lightweight Crossbow Upper: Aimed at hunters who prioritize mobility, this upper usually weighs less and has a lower draw weight. It’s ideal for small game hunting or for those who need to carry their crossbow over long distances, providing ease of use without sacrificing too much power.
- High-Powered Crossbow Upper: These uppers are built for serious hunters looking to take down larger game from a distance. With draw weights often exceeding 200 lbs and advanced optics, they offer enhanced accuracy and penetration, making them suitable for big game like elk or bear.
- Recurve Crossbow Upper: This upper type features a traditional design and is favored by those who appreciate simplicity and reliability. Recurve crossbows are known for their ease of maintenance and can deliver good performance, making them a solid choice for both novice and experienced hunters.
- Compound Crossbow Upper: Utilizing a system of pulleys and cams, these uppers offer higher speeds and energy efficiency. They are popular among serious hunters due to their compact design and ability to shoot arrows at greater velocities, making them effective for both target shooting and hunting.
- Crossbow Upper with Integrated Accessories: These models come equipped with additional features like scopes, quivers, and stabilizers for enhanced usability. They are ideal for hunters who want a ready-to-use setup that maximizes accuracy and convenience right out of the box.

What Materials Are Commonly Used in Crossbow Uppers and Why Does It Matter?
The materials used in crossbow uppers significantly impact durability, weight, and performance.
- Aluminum: Aluminum is a popular choice for crossbow uppers due to its lightweight nature and resistance to corrosion. Its strength-to-weight ratio allows for a sturdy design without adding excessive weight, making it ideal for hunters who need mobility in the field.
- Carbon Fiber: Carbon fiber is favored for high-end crossbow uppers because of its exceptional strength and lightness. This material absorbs vibrations well, enhancing accuracy, and its high tensile strength allows for a more streamlined and aerodynamic design.
- Polymer: Many crossbow uppers are made from high-grade polymer, which offers a balance of weight and durability. This material is often more affordable than metals and is resistant to weather conditions, making it suitable for outdoor use without the risk of rust or degradation.
- Steel: Steel is utilized in some crossbow uppers for its unmatched strength and durability. Although heavier than other materials, steel components can enhance the overall robustness of the crossbow, providing reliability in extreme conditions, but may require additional considerations for weight management.
- Wood: While less common in modern designs, wood is occasionally used for crossbow uppers, primarily for aesthetic purposes and traditional designs. Wood can provide a classic look and feel, but it is heavier and less durable than synthetic materials, making it less practical for high-performance applications.
What Accessories Can Enhance the Performance of Crossbow Uppers?
Several accessories can greatly enhance the performance of crossbow uppers:
- Optics: Quality optics such as scopes or red dot sights greatly improve accuracy and target acquisition. They help to magnify the target, allowing for better precision at longer distances, which is crucial for hunting or competitive shooting.
- Stabilizers: Stabilizers help to balance the crossbow, reducing vibrations and improving shot consistency. By minimizing hand torque and providing a steadier aim, they can significantly enhance shooting performance.
- Quivers: A good quiver not only holds arrows securely but also allows for quick and easy access. The right quiver can reduce the weight on the crossbow and ensure that arrows are within easy reach when seconds count during a hunt.
- String Dampeners: These accessories reduce the noise and vibration produced when the crossbow is fired. By minimizing the sound signature, string dampeners help hunters remain stealthy and avoid alerting game animals.
- Foregrips: Adding a foregrip can improve handling and comfort, allowing for a more stable shooting platform. A well-placed grip can help shooters maintain better control and reduce fatigue during extended use.
- Custom Arrows: Using arrows that are specifically matched to the crossbow’s specifications can improve flight stability and accuracy. Custom arrows are designed for weight, length, and fletching type to optimize performance based on the crossbow upper’s power and purpose.
- Trigger Upgrades: A high-quality trigger can enhance the shooting experience by providing a smoother pull and reducing trigger creep. This allows for more precise shots and can lead to better overall accuracy.
